A method may include learning reward functions for a plurality of first vehicles based on first vehicle data associated with the plurality of first vehicles using inverse reinforcement learning, associating each vehicle of the plurality of first vehicles with one cluster among a plurality of clusters based on the reward functions, determining a centroid reward function for each of the clusters based on the reward functions associated with each cluster, performing a comparison between second vehicle data associated with a second vehicle and the first vehicle data, determining a vehicle among the plurality of first vehicles having associated first vehicle data that is most similar to the second vehicle data based on the comparison, associating the second vehicle with the cluster associated with the determined vehicle, and controlling operation of the second vehicle based on the centroid reward function of the cluster associated with the second vehicle.
